The character became so popular so quickly that even non-Star Wars fans now know who Mando’s cute sidekick is. Showrunner Jon Favreau initially thought that Baby Yoda would steal attention from the plot’s serious tone, fearing that the puppet may be too cute. As such, the producers went to great lengths to make sure that people wouldn’t fall head over heels in love with the Child, making him hairy and giving him crooked teeth. Alas, none of these tricks quite worked, and Baby Yoda ended up being even more popular than the series that gave birth to him.

As you’d imagine, the Mouse House has stood to profit from the Baby Yoda craze, with toy manufacturers having a difficult time trying to meet demand.
